Sometimes the client will refuse to let me right click an individual song from an album, even if its a song that it's let me do that before, which will make queue building and playlist creation frustrating.
It lets me do it no problem if I click on the album name, but if I click on the song in album's section of the artist overview, it refuses to let me pick it until either I restart my client or go to the album's page in the client.
I don't see this all the time, but it only started happening a couple updates ago.
Anyone else see this? I would have taken pictures if I could produce a consistent result, but it just seems to randomly.
Bumping this. Still seeing this after a clean reinstall. It's starting to happen almost all the time now, regardless of restarting, and it will stop happening randomly and then start again.
It only seems to be specific artists too. Skee-Lo being one of them. Blur is another, but only for part of their discography (The Great Escape and releases below it).
I'm pretty sure that this is a UI bug, but I could be wrong.
